UPVC Door Hinge Replacement

UPVC doors provide durability and security, making them a popular option for homeowners. Over time, hinges could be displaced and loose. This can lead to leaks and draughts.

doorpanels-300x200.jpgTo avoid these problems homeowners should regularly clean and grease their UPVC door. Use industrial Vaseline or other lubricants.

UPVC hinges are made in a variety of designs and are used to join a door frame with sash. They are designed to support the weight and ensure smooth operation. UPVC hinges come in various dimensions and materials, so it is important to select the best one for your requirements.

Butt hinges are the most commonly used uPVC hings. They are made up of two hinge leaves (or plates) and the hinge pin. Both hinge leaves have holes for screws to help them stay in position. The hinge pin is inserted into the knuckles and helps hold both plates together.

There are a few reasons that your uPVC doors might not close correctly. The most common reason is a misaligned hinge. You can fix this by loosening the screws and adjusting them. Another reason is that the latch is not hitting the strike plate. In this case you should seek the advice of an expert to examine and adjust the latching mechanisms.

Most uPVC doors feature hinges that can be adjusted to allow you to fine-tune the alignment and clearance of your door. This can improve the appearance and functionality of your door, as well as help prevent water leaks. You can also lubricate the hinges to keep them moving smoothly.

Selecting the right kind of window hinge repairs near me is vital to your door's safety and functionality. The three main types are butt, rebated and flag hinges. Flag hinges are attached to the outside of the door, and butt hinges are inserted into a hole in the frame of the door. Rebated hinges can be hard to locate, but they are simple to set up and adjust.

You can make use of a fixing tool to ensure that the sash remains positioned centrally on the frame. It is a good idea to also test the weight on each of the three hinges. When you are sure that the sash has been weighed equally on all hinges, it is time to begin to fit it on the door.

Install x3 hinges for flags onto the standard uPVC Sash. The top hinge should be placed 150mm above the top edge of the sash. The bottom hinge should also be 150mm below the bottom edge. The middle hinge is positioned in between the two outer ones.

There are many kinds of uPVC hinges available on the market. Each has its own distinctive characteristic. The kind of hinge you select will depend on your requirements and budget. Some common uPVC door hinges include flag or T hinges, as well as butt hinges. Flag hinges are the most well-known and are found on most modern doors made of uPVC. These hinges are designed to support a larger sash and allow for vertical and horizontal adjustments.

T hinges can be adjusted horizontally and vertically. Butt hinges are typically found on older doors, and are only adjustable laterally.

upvc door hinge and its hardware are designed to last, but they still can suffer from wear and tears. They are exposed to extreme weather conditions and daily traffic. They could begin to creak or become stuck. You can fix the issue by changing hinges or adjusting them.

The hinges of uPVC aluminium doors hinges are usually misaligned. This can be caused by normal wear and tear or dirt and debris. It is possible to fix the issue with an allen key and screwdriver to adjust the hinges. By turning the screw clockwise, you can tighten and raise the sash. Turning it counterclockwise will loosen the sash and lower it.
